In a historic partnership, the Shreveport-Bossier Convention and Tourist Bureau (SBCTB), together with the City of Shreveport, City of Bossier City, Greater Shreveport Chamber of Commerce, Bossier Chamber of Commerce, Shreveport-Bossier African American Chamber of Commerce, and other local community organizations are working together to develop a Destination Master Plan and Community Brand.

The primary goal of the Destination Master Plan is to set goals and create initiatives over the next 10 years to attract more investment into the community and increase overall visitor spending here. The project will provide a wider variety of jobs, increase the local tax base, help fund community amenities and services, support special events, attract corporate investment and relocation, enhance civic pride, and improve overall quality of life.

In early September 2022, three town halls were held in Shreveport-Bossier at the following locations:
- Alphonse Jackson Jr. Hall, Southern University at Shreveport
- Louisiana Tech Research Institute Academic Success Center, Bossier Parish Community College
- Market 104 at Hilton Shreveport
